|z| means modulus of z. That is, whatever the sign (+ or -) of the value of z, |z| is the positive equivalent (or zero).

For example,
|3| = 3
|-6| = 6
|6| = 6
|0| = 0

Now if you had |y| = 1 there are two possible values for y.
Firstly, assume y is positive or zero (y >= 0). In this case, regardless of what y is, |y| = y (because |y| just asks for the positive equivalent of y and y is already positive).
You would then have |y| = y = 1. This is your first answer for |y| = 1

But you must also consider the possibility y is negative (y < 0). Since |y| converts y to a postive value, you can say that if y < 0 then |y| = -y (since if y is negative, -y will be positive).
Therefore, |y| = -y = 1, y = -1

Hence, if |y| = 1, then y = 1 or y = -1.

In relation to your question, you need to consider two possibilities:

If 12 - 3x >= 0 (positive)
Then |12 - 3x| = 12 - 3x = 9
3x = 12 - 9 = 3
x = 1

If 12 - 3x < 0 (negative)
Then |12 - 3x| = -(12 - 3x) = 9
-12 + 3x = 9
3x = 21
x = 7

So the other solution is x = 7.
